DEVINE v. POPE

No. 24702.

423 F.2d 32 (1970)

George DEVINE, Appellant, v. Lester POPE, Appellee.

United States Court of Appeals, Ninth Circuit.

March 13, 1970.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

C. Affton Moore, III, Sacramento, Cal., for appellant.

Thomas Kerrigan, Deputy Atty. Gen., Thomas C. Lynch, Atty. Gen., State of California, Los Angeles, Cal., for appellee.

Before ELY and KILKENNY, Circuit Judges, and BYRNE, District Judge.


PER CURIAM.

This appeal is from the District Court's denial of Devine's petition for writ of habeas corpus. When he filed his petition, Devine was a California state prisoner, but we are advised that he has now been released on parole.
